Preparing Your Space for Installation

Starting with preparing your space is essential for a seamless indoor water wall fountain installation. I often advise clients to clear the area of furniture and decorations to avoid any potential damage during the process. Ensuring that the floor is level is crucial as it directly influences the fountain‘s water flow; an unbalanced base can lead to water spillage or uneven distribution.

During my consultations, I stress the importance of locating power sources prior to installation: the need for an electrical outlet cannot be overlooked since the pump and lighting of the water wall fountain require power. It’s equally important to measure the dimensions of your chosen wall meticulously, factoring in both the fountain‘s size and additional space for maintenance access.

Equipping your space with the proper tools and supplies before beginning the installation will streamline the process: waterproof adhesives, mounting equipment, and a water fill hose are among the essentials. Here is a straightforward checklist of items to gather before starting your project:

  • Waterproof adhesive and sealant
  • Secure mounting brackets
  • Drill and drill bits suited for your wall material
  • Level for ensuring even placement
  • Stud finder for wall support locations
  • Water fill hose or bucket for initial fountain fill-up

Safety Tips and Best Practices

When installing indoor water wall fountains, prioritizing electrical safety is paramount. I always ensure that the power supply is switched off before beginning the installation to prevent any risk of electrical shock. It’s also vital to use grounded, waterproof power outlets specifically designed for high-moisture areas to maintain the utmost safety standards. This approach minimizes risks and secures the longevity of the water feature’s electrical components.

Handling the weight of water wall fountains requires care and precision; thus, I advocate for always enlisting at least two people for the mounting process. Confirming that wall brackets are anchored securely into studs helps distribute the fountain‘s weight evenly. This practice not only prevents potential damage to the wall but also ensures that the fountain remains stable, reducing the likelihood of accidents or water spillage.

Consistent maintenance is crucial for sustaining the performance and safety of indoor water wall fountains. I perform regular inspections to check for any signs of wear or leakage, which could lead to water damage or mold growth. Keeping the water feature clean, and the pump clear of debris, helps to prevent malfunctions that might require costly repairs or result in unexpected downtime. This preventative care is essential for the enduring appeal and functionality of the installation.

Routine Cleaning Procedures

Ensuring the longevity and pristine condition of your indoor water wall fountain hinges on regular maintenance. I recommend a weekly ritual of wiping the surface to prevent mineral buildup, particularly if you’re using hard water. Gentle, non-abrasive cleaners coupled with a soft cloth can keep the feature’s façade radiant and free of streaks or spots, preserving the fountain‘s aesthetic allure.

In my experience, the water quality within the fountain is paramount to prevent algae growth and ensure the system’s smooth operation. Monthly, I advise clients to drain and refill the fountain with distilled or filtered water, an easy procedure that curtails any impurities that could clog the pump or mar the fountain‘s appearance. This routine attention assures the clarity and cleanliness of the water, a crucial aspect of the fountain‘s serene impact.

It’s also indispensable to inspect the pump and clean it biannually to sidestep any mechanical issues that could lead to malfunction or reduced water flow. I’ve found that a simple brush and gentle rinse can remove any debris that has accumulated over time. This proactive step guarantees that the tranquil sound of your water feature remains constant, contributing to the peaceful ambiance of your space.

Addressing Common Issues and Troubleshooting

In my experience, one common issue with indoor water wall fountains is an inconsistent water flow that can detract from the visual appeal and the soothing auditory experience. To address this, I inspect the pump and water level, verifying that the pump is fully submerged and clearing any potential blockages in the tubing. Adjusting the speed control dial on the pump can also remedy this issue, restoring the gentle cascade that defines these tranquil installations.

Another prevalent concern is the formation of mineral deposits on the surface, especially in regions with hard water. I recommend using distilled water to mitigate this, but if deposits do form, a thorough cleaning with a vinegar solution often restores the surface. It’s essential to follow this up with a rinse and refill to ensure no vinegar remains, which could affect the pump operation and water quality.

I’ve often been approached with questions regarding unusual noises coming from water wall fountains, which can disrupt the serene atmosphere they’re meant to create. In such cases, I check for air trapped in the pump or the fountain‘s panels. This can usually be resolved by adjusting the water flow or gently tapping the panels to release any trapped air bubbles, quickly returning the space to its peaceful state.
